Hive账号注册与认证机制详解
2024.01.05 16:00浏览量:248简介:Hive账号注册和认证过程对于数据安全和访问控制至关重要。本文将介绍如何在Hive中注册账号,以及Hive的认证机制。通过了解这些知识,您将能够更好地管理Hive环境,确保数据的安全性和完整性。
在Hive中注册账号的过程相对简单,通常涉及以下步骤:
- 打开Hive管理界面:首先,您需要访问Hive的管理界面。这通常是通过Web浏览器完成的,地址通常是
http://<hive_server_ip>:10000/。 - 创建新用户:在Hive管理界面上,您应该能够找到一个选项来创建新用户。点击该选项,您将被引导到一个表单,其中包含用于填写新用户信息的字段。
- 填写用户信息:在表单中,您需要提供一些必要的信息,如用户名、密码和其他可选信息(如电子邮件地址)。确保提供准确和完整的信息,以便在需要时进行验证或联系。
- 提交注册信息:完成表单填写后,点击提交按钮。Hive将处理您的请求,并在成功的情况下创建一个新用户帐户。
需要注意的是,具体注册流程可能因Hive的版本和配置而有所不同。始终参考适用于您环境的Hive文档以获取准确的指导。
一旦您成功注册了Hive账号,接下来是了解Hive的认证机制。认证是验证用户身份的过程,确保用户有权访问Hive服务。以下是Hive认证机制的关键组成部分: - 用户名和密码:最常见的认证方法是使用用户名和密码。当用户尝试连接Hive时,他们需要提供正确的用户名和密码组合以通过认证。确保为每个用户设置独特的密码,并定期更改密码以提高安全性。
- 访问控制列表(ACL):ACL是一种机制,用于定义哪些用户或用户组可以访问特定的Hive资源或执行特定操作。通过配置ACL,您可以控制对数据库、表或其他对象的访问,从而实施细粒度的访问控制。
- 角色-Based Access Control(RBAC):RBAC是一种基于角色的访问控制方法,其中权限是根据角色分配给用户的。通过将一组权限分配给角色,然后将角色分配给用户,您可以方便地管理权限并简化安全策略的实施。
- Kerberos认证:对于更高级的安全需求,可以使用Kerberos认证。Kerberos是一种网络认证协议,用于在不安全的网络环境中提供安全的身份验证和授权。通过Kerberos,用户可以凭借受信任的身份验证票据访问Hive服务。
- SSL/TLS加密:为了进一步增强安全性,您可以配置SSL/TLS加密来保护Hive通信。通过使用SSL/TLS证书和加密通信协议,您可以确保数据在传输过程中的机密性和完整性。
为了确保最佳安全性,建议定期审查和更新认证机制,并采取适当的安全措施来保护Hive环境。此外,密切关注安全最佳实践和新兴威胁,以便及时调整安全策略以应对不断变化的威胁环境。

发表评论
登录后可评论,请前往 登录 或 注册